Shopian gunfight:Two militants killed, operation still on

Shopian: Two militants have been killed in the gunfight that erupted in the Batmuran village of District shopian monday evening.

according to police sources two militants have been killed after the house they were hiding in was blasted by forces.

“One army personnel recieved injuries and one more militant could be still trapped inside,” police sources said.

The operation is still in progress, sources said.
